What is mlr3filters?

mlr3filters grows one feature-selection filter at a time

mlr3filters provides feature-filter methods to mlr3. Its releases follow a consistent shape: one or two new filters, broader feature-type support on existing ones, and error-message work. Boruta and a univariate Cox filter arrived in 0.8.0; 0.9.0 extended Boruta to logical, factor and ordered features and moved param_set to an active binding.

What is mlr3proba?

mlr3proba is shedding weight as its survival work moves into sibling packages

mlr3proba provides probabilistic supervised learning for mlr3 — survival analysis, density estimation, and the measures that go with them. Recent releases are almost entirely upkeep: a distr6 fork to work around an upstream problem, an ooplah fix, a predict-type correction, and registration in mlr_reflections$loaded_packages. The one deletion is telling, with LearnerDensPenalized removed after pendensity left CRAN.

◆ Where it's heading

This is incremental infrastructure that tracks mlr3's own conventions — cli printing, prototype-based dictionaries, featureless learners as defaults — while slowly widening which data types each filter accepts. Nothing in the recent history suggests a change of scope.

◆ Where it's heading

The package is being pared back rather than extended. Its README now points at survdistr and mlr3cmprsk as matured alternatives for parts of what it covers, which reads as scope being handed off, while the Cox proportional-hazards autoplot arrived from mlr3viz in the other direction. Several fixes exist to route around dependencies that broke or disappeared, which is the recurring cost of building on a long chain of specialized CRAN packages.
